WebTennis elbow (lateral epicondylitis) and golfer’s elbow (medial epicondylitis) are painful conditions caused by overuse of the muscles and tendons in your forearm. Specific exercises will help with the healing process and … Web15 Sep 2024 · What can cause Tennis Elbow? About 5 in 1,000 adults develop tennis elbow each year. It mainly affects people between the ages of 35 and 55. Women and men are affected equally. Tennis elbow is caused by activities that require repetitive or excessive straightening of the wrist. This can include. Over use activities at home. Gardening e.g. …

WebRange of Movement Exercises: 1. Warm up your arm by bending and straightening your elbow. Repeat 20 times. 2. Bend your elbow as far as you can. Then with your other hand, hold around your forearm and bend the elbow further, holding the stretch for 3-5 minutes. This may be uncomfortable but not painful, so you can tolerate it. Webwww.wiltshirehealthandcare.nhs.uk Date of last review: 03/01/2024 Document Ref: 301208 4 Pages Printed on 20/03/2024 at 10:47 AM Tennis Elbow (Lateral Epicondylosis) What is Tennis Elbow? Tennis elbow is also known as lateral epicondylitis or lateral elbow pain. It is a condition that results in pain around the outside of the elbow.
